There are many different types of database management systems (DBMS) available, so it’s important to choose the right one for your business needs.
Here are some questions to ask when choosing a DBMS:
1. What types of data do you need to store?
A: Depending on the type of business, different data will need to be stored. For example, a retail business will need to track customer information, inventory levels, and sales data. A healthcare organization will need to track patient medical records, insurance information, and appointment schedules.
2. How much data do you need to store?
A: The amount of data that needs to be stored will affect the size and type of database you need. A small business with a few hundred customers may only need a small database, while a large enterprise with millions of customers will need a much larger database.
3. How often do you need to access the data?
A: If you only need to access the data occasionally, such as for reports or analysis, then you may not need a real-time database. However, if you need to access the data frequently, such as for customer transactions or operational processes, then you will need a real-time database.
4. How many users need to access the data?
A: If only a few users need to access the data, then you may be able to get by with a smaller, less expensive database. However, if hundreds or thousands of users need to access the data, then you will need a larger, more powerful database.
5. What type of performance do you need?
A: Depending on how the database will be used, different performance requirements will be needed. For example, an online transaction system will need fast response times, while a data warehouse will need to be able to handle large volumes of data.
6. What type of security do you need?
A: Depending on the sensitivity of the data being stored, different security requirements will be needed. For example, medical records or financial information will need to be heavily secured, while less sensitive data may not need as much security.
7. What type of availability do you need?
A: Depending on how critical the database is to your business, different availability requirements will be needed. For example, if the database is used for mission-critical applications, then you will need a high availability solution that can withstand hardware and software failures. However, if the database is only used for non-critical applications, then you may not need as high of an availability solution.
8. What type of scalability do you need?
A: Depending on how fast your business is growing, different scalability requirements will be needed. For example, if you are adding new customers or data at a rapid pace, then you will need a database that can easily scale to accommodate the growth. However, if your business is growing slowly, then you may not need as much scalability.
9. What types of features do you need?
A: Depending on how the database will be used, different features will be needed. For example, if you need to generate reports or perform analysis, then you will need a database with reporting and analytical features. If you need to support transactions or process data in real-time, then you will need a database with transaction and processing features.
10. What is your budget?
A: Depending on your available budget, you may be able to choose from a variety of different database management systems. For example, if you have a limited budget, then you may want to consider an open-source DBMS. If you have a larger budget, then you may want to consider a commercial DBMS.
These are just some of the questions to ask when choosing a database management system for your business. The right DBMS for your business will depend on your specific needs and requirements.
Conclusion:
The right database management system for your business will depend on your specific needs and requirements. Be sure to consider all of the factors listed above before making your decision.